Bisi Oladele heads South West online publishers exco

Bisi Oladele, former Bureau Chief of the The Nation newspaper, has been elected as Chairman of the South West Guild of Online Publishers (SWEGOP).

Oladele succeeded Olayinka Agboola as the chairman of the association following an election of the body held on Thursday at the Nigerian Union of Journalists (NUJ) Press Centre, Iyaganku, Ibadan.

Dapo Falade emerged as the Vice Chairman while Taiwo Oluwadamilare was appointed as Secretary. Joseph Okuwofu was named as Assistant Secretary.

Other elected officers of SWEGOP are Oluwatoyin Malik (Mrs.) who was elected as Treasurer; Temi Aboderin, Financial Secretary; and Remi Oladoye, who retained his position as the Public Relations Officer (PRO).

Tunde Busari who coordinated the process, urged the new executive council members to uphold the trust reposed in them and work towards advancing the association’s mission.

In his handing over speech, Agboola assured the new executive of his continued support and guidance, emphasising that his doors remained open for advice and collaboration.

Oladele expressed gratitude to members of the association for the confidence reposed in the new executive, saying, “We are very conscious of how challenging the journey has been to this stage. Thank you for trusting us with your votes to lead this association. 

“We acknowledge the challenges SWEGOP faces but with the support of the last executive and our members, we are confident in achieving our goals.” 

The newly elected chairman lauded Agboola for his contributions to the guild in the last nine years. He specially saluted his efforts towards expanding SWEGOP’s membership and for his dedication to strengthening the association.

According to him, the house has been dissolved, and there will be a fresh registration for members with new rules of engagement and regulations for them to follow.

He called for support and collaboration of all members in a bid to move the association forward.
